body, html {	scrollbar-face-color: #cccccc; 	scrollbar-shadow-color: #ffccff; 	scrollbar-highlight-color: #808080; 	scrollbar-3dlight-color: #555555; 	scrollbar-darkshadow-color: #dddddd; 	scrollbar-track-color: #c0c0c0; 	scrollbar-arrow-color: #cc0000;	font-family: tahoma, arial, helvetica, serif;	font-size: 12px;	background: black;	text-align: center;	padding: 0px;	margin: 0px auto;	}body {	margin: 10px 0px;	}#container {	background: url(images/background.jpg) top left repeat;	border: 1px solid #808080;	width: 760px;	height: auto;	text-align: left;	margin: 0 auto;	padding: 0px;	position: relative;	}#homecontainer {	background: url(images/background.jpg) top left repeat;	border: 1px solid #808080;	width: 760px;	height: 560px;	text-align: left;	margin: 0 auto;	padding: 0px;	position: relative;	}img {	border: none;	}image#header {	width: 760px;	height: 100px;	}image#home {	width: 420px;	height: 350px;	}image#thumbnail { 	width: 56px;	height: 44px;				}image#large { 	width: 420px;	height: 320px;				}h1 {    background-color: #cccccc;	width: 260px;	font-size: 16px;	text-align: center;	margin: 0px;	margin-top: 10px;	margin-bottom: 10px;	margin-left: 250px;	padding: 0px;	}#nav, #nav ul {	float: left;	width: 758px;	list-style: none;	line-height: 1.6em;	background: #c0c0c0;	font-weight: bold;	padding: 0 0 0 1px;	margin: 0 0 -10px 0;	z-index: 3;	}#nav a {	display: block;	width: 126px;	height: 1.6em;	color: black;	text-align: center;	text-decoration: none;	}#nav a.daddy {	}#nav li {	float: left;	padding: 0px;	width: 126px;}#nav li ul {	position: absolute;	left: -999em;	height: auto;	width: 146px;	w\idth: 146px;	font-weight: bold;	margin: 0px;}#nav li li {	padding: 0px;	width: 146px;}#nav li ul a {	width: 146px;	text-align: left;	}#nav li ul ul {	margin: -1.75em 0 0 106px;}#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ul {	left: -999em;	}#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ul {	left: auto;	}#nav li:hover, #nav li.sfhover {	background: #cccccc;	}#content {	width: auto;	height: 430px;	position: relative;	top:20px;	left:0px;	margin: 0px;	padding: 0px;	}#content a {	color: black;	text-decoration: none;	font-weight: bold;	font-size: 10px;	margin: 0px;	padding: 0px;	}#content a:hover {	text-decoration: none;	background: #c0c0c0;	}.leftbox {	width: 430px;	height: 360px;	float: left;	margin: 0px;	padding: 0px;	padding-bottom: 10px;	margin-left: 10px;	}.leftbox h2{	width: 280px;	font-size: 14px;	text-align: left;	letter-spacing: 0.1em;	margin: 0px;	padding: 0px;	padding-bottom: 10px;	}.rightbox {	width: 290px;	height: 360px;	float: right;	margin: 0px;	padding: 0px;	padding-top: 10px;	margin-right: 10px;	}.rightbox p {	margin: 0px;	margin-bottom: 10px;	font-size: 12px;	}.location {	width: 260px;	height: 240px;	position: absolute;	top: 30px;	right: 30px;	}.product	{	width: 760px;	height: 530px;	margin: 0px;	padding: 0px;	position: relative;	top:20px;	left:0px;	}.abcmap	{	width: 740px;	height: 480px;	margin: 0px 10px;	padding:0px;	position: relative;	top:20px;	left:0px;	}.abcglossary	{	width: 740px;	height: 400px;	margin: 0px 10px;	padding:0px;	position: relative;	top:20px;	left:0px;	}.describe {	width: 305px;	height: auto;	margin: 0px;	padding: 0px;	padding-top: 0px;	position: absolute;	left: 10px;	top: 10px;	}.describe h2 {	width: 280px;	font-size: 14px;	text-align: left;	letter-spacing: 0.1em;	margin: 0px;	margin-bottom: 10px;	padding: 0px;	}.describe p {	width: auto;	height: auto;	margin: 0px;	padding: 0px;	margin-bottom: 10px;	}#footnav {	width: 128px;	text-decoration: none;	font-weight: bold;	padding: 0px;	margin: 0px;	position: absolute;	bottom: 2px;	right: 2px;	}#footnav ul {	list-style-type: none;	display: inline;	margin: 0px;	padding: 0px;	float: right;	}#footnav ul li {	list-style-type: none;	display: block;	float: left;	margin: 0px;	padding: 0px;	}#footnav a {	background-color: #cccccc;	border: 1px solid #993333;	text-decoration: none;	width: 62px;	color: black;	font-size: 9px;	text-align: center;	display: block;	}#footnav a:link {	text-decoration: none;	}#footnav a:visited {	text-decoration: none;	}#footnav a:hover {	background-color: #c0c0c0;	text-decoration: none;	}#footnav a:active {	text-decoration: none;	}.pushit {	position: relative;	top: 0px;	left: 3px;	}.Q  	{	text:"Q-Case";	}
